However, before you embark on the repair process, remember, safety comes first. Always perform a thorough damage assessment to ascertain the depth and extent of the scrapes. Seek professional help if the cuts are exceptionally deep, are close to any bonding areas or around the bike’s essential elements, such as the fork or seat post. The course of action for both shallow and deep abrasions are discussed below:

Shallow Scratch Repair:

For slight blemishes that have not penetrated the epoxy layer, the carbon bike scratch repair carbon bike scratch repair process is quite simple. Cleanse the area with soap and water to remove any dirt. Dry thoroughly. Then, using a high-grit sandpaper, gently sand the region until the scratch has disappeared. After achieving the desired smoothness, clean the area again, and dry. Finally, apply a clear coat of lacquer for a neat finish.

In the case of colored bikes, use a lacquer that matches the bike’s color instead of the clear coat. If a color-match is not available, you can always adhere a decal in the area after applying the basic clear lacquer.

Deep Scratch Repair:

When dealing with deep scratches that have penetrated the epoxy layer and exposed the carbon fibrils, do not try repairing it yourself – a carbon bike scratch repair is required. Carbon fiber is a compound material that is formed by intertwining carbon fibrils with hardened epoxy. If the fibers are exposed, it could mean that the bicycle’s structural integrity is threatened, and professional help should be sought.

Rest assured, professional carbon bike scratch repair is a cost-effective solution. Experts will assess the damage, reinforce the area with additional layers of carbon fiber, if required, and finally, apply a flawless layer of paint to return your bike to its original appearance.
